What is the best cleaner to clean glass?
- Solution 1: Equal parts distilled white vinegar and water.
- Solution 2: Two tablespoons of ammonia and two quarts of warm water.
- Solution 3: Two tablespoons of dishwashing liquid and two quarts of water.

What is the best way to clean windows without streaking?
Newspapers and microfiber towels are best for wiping and drying windows without the risk of leaving streaks. You can also use paper towels, but some paper towels may leave behind lint. Vinegar is a miracle from nature. … The acidic composition of vinegar acts quickly to break down the kind of film that frequently accumulates on glass surfaces. When you wash a window using a solution that contains vinegar, the results will almost always be free from streaks and sparkling clean.

What do professional window washers use to wash windows?
Pro cleaners use squeegees inside all the time, even in houses with stained and varnished woodwork. When cleaning windows with a squeegee indoors, the key is to squeeze most of the soapy water out of the scrubber to eliminate excessive dripping and running.

Is rubbing alcohol good for cleaning glass?
Rubbing alcohol is a potent cleaner but is harsh and strong-smelling, so it’s not a great glass cleaner by itself. Combining ingredients is the secret to making a homemade glass cleaner that cleans well without streaking, just like the store-bought formulas.

Should you clean windows on a sunny day?
It turns out that cleaning your windows on a sunny day is a major no-no, according to the cleaning experts at the Good Housekeeping Institute. … ‘Firstly, avoid cleaning your windows on very sunny days – the heat will make the glass dry too quickly and cause smears,’ says the GHI.

Why does newspaper clean glass so well?
The high absorbency of the newsprint is likely what makes it so effective at cleaning windows. It actually absorbs the liquid instead of just pushing it around. And glass is a slick, non-porous surface, so the ink doesn’t adhere to it like it does wood molding.
What is the best rag to use to clean windows?
Microfiber cloths are absorbent cloths that can be washed and reused to clean windows, leaving them clear, shiny and streak-free. These are best used to apply cleaning solutions to windows, scrub them clean and wipe them dry. Best of all, they are soft and pose no risk to your windows.
Can I use a cloth with Windex?
Don’t use an absorbent paper towel or cloth treated with fabric softener to spread the solution because you’ll also end up leaving lint and film behind. To avoid streaks use an untreated paper towel, newspaper or lint-free cloth. According to Windex, old cotton diapers (unused, of course) are a good choice.

What happens when you mix vinegar and rubbing alcohol?
Using isopropyl alcohol and white vinegar together makes a quickly evaporating spray glass and mirror cleaner that competes with national brands. This can also be used to give a nice shine to hard tiles, chrome, and other surfaces.
What can I use instead of rubbing alcohol for cleaning glass?
A spray bottle filled with half water and half distilled white vinegar will help remove grime and hard water spots from glass and mirrors. If there is a lot of buildup on the glass surface to be cleaned, raise the ratio of vinegar to water for more cleaning power.

Will soft scrub scratch glass?
Apply a mild abrasive such as Soft Scrub, Bar Keepers Friend or Bon Ami to a soft rag and scrub. These products usually won’t scratch glass, but start in a small, inconspicuous spot just to make sure. … You can use a similar method on glass shower doors (Photo 2).
